Lucknow, 5 July : No religion of the world supports homosexual behaviour and the leaders of all faith have termed it as unnatural. The Hon'ble High Court of Delhi's recent judgement of legalizing homosexuality despite this opposition is like a serious blow on youth and society and therefore, is absolutely unacceptable. These views were unanimously expressed by the leaders of various religious faiths at CMS Gomti Nagar auditorium today. These leaders of various religions viz Hindu, Muslim, Sikh, Parsi, Jain, Boudha, Baha'i, Christian etc. had assembled here to take part in a special discussion organized by City Montessori School to put forth their views on the Delhi High Court's judgement of legalizing homosexual behaviour. Unanimously criticizing the Delhi High Court's judgement, the leaders of all religions faiths urged the Supreme Court of India, Central Government and all state governments to intervene and review this judgement so as to prevent the youth from being carried away and the entire social set up being broken up.

Various religious leaders present on the occasion were Maulana Khalid Rashid, Maulana Kasal Kafil Ashraf, Maulana Syydur Rahman Azmi, Principal, Nadwa College; Maulana Saklain Abidi; Maulana Abbas Irshad Naqvi; Maulana Yasoob Abbas, Spokesperson, All India Shia Personal Law Board; Maulana Shahfazle Rahman Waizi; Maulana Nidahat Azmi; Maulana Syyed Shah Fazlul Mannan; Maulana Abdul Ali Faruqui; Maulana Abdul Karim Faruqui; Maulana Farookh Alvi; Bishop Gerald J. Mathias etc. After the discussions these leaders of various faiths met media persons at a press conference and put forth their views on the topic.
